What is the
effect of rain and weather conditions on the service?
Link-Sat took this into consideration and, for Ku band, chose a satellite provider
with very strong signal quality and powerful beam over West
Africa. In addition to the choice of satellite, we use a 2 or 4 watt BUC as
a standard to mitigate against the effect of adverse weather condition. Our
VSAT equipment sales to customers takes into consideration the effect of
rain and weather conditions of your area. A 1.8 meter dish is highly recommended for customers who are located high rain frequency areas. C band
service, which is affected little by rain, is also available and is particularly suitable for customers requiring 24/7 service in high rainfall areas anywhere in Africa.
What are
the minimum computer requirements for satellite Internet access?
Minimum computer requirements:
• Celeron 366-MHz or Pentium 300-MHz, with ethernet LAN connector
• Windows 98/Me/XP/2000 or Windows NT 4.0 (Service Pack 6 Recommended)
Operating System
• 10-MB of disk storage for application program and driver
• 10-MB minimum for data cache
• 2D graphics card (3D graphics recommended)
• Satellite dish and satellite Internet service
• Microsoft Internet Explorer (web browser) version 5.0 or later installed
• Microsoft Windows Media Player version 6.4 or later
• Microsoft DirectX 7 or later
• Minimum Screen resolution of 800 x 600
What protocols are supported?
The current system supports HTTP, FTP and Socks proxy, NNTP and POP3
services. If the protocol is not supported then you can download the needed
protocols after your site is activated.
